The size of Eden Park is approximately 24.2 square kilometres. The population of Eden Park in 2016 was 1204 people. By 2021 the population was 1194 showing a population decline of 0.8%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Eden Park is 50-59 years. Households in Eden Park are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$2400 - $2999 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Eden Park work in a trades occupation.In 2021, 94.30% of the homes in Eden Park were owner-occupied compared with 92.10% in 2016.
